Ohio State had four players at the 2012 NFL combine and none of them had particularly high class performances, but none of them were really expected to be world beaters in the first place.
Wide Receiver DeVier Posey got the biggest boost grade wise, earning a 76.5 score from NFL.com after his combine performance, tops among Ohio State players and 13th overall among wide receivers.
From a Cleveland Browns look at things, not much changed with Robert Griffin III having an absolutely sparkling performance to keep himself likely at the second overall position on most draft charts. It's still unclear if the Browns will be able to muster enough to take the pick from St. Louis, or if they even want to do so.
